The Human Resource Assistant is responsible for performing relevant tasks in the department such as recruitment, hiring, and managing the onboarding of new employees and the needs of existing employees. He or She also provides support to managers and employees through a variety of tasks related to organization and communication to ensure the efficient operation of the HR department and the entire office.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Perform administrative duties, such as maintaining an employee database and sorting emails for the HR department
- Maintain accurate records of employee attendance and leave
- Assist the HR Head with policy formulation, hiring, and salary administration
- Submit online job postings, shortlist candidates, and set up interviews
- Coordinate orientation and training sessions for new employees
- Ensure smooth communication with employees and timely resolution of their inquiries
- Answer and direct phone calls, and respond to email, phone, or in-person inquiries
- Handle sensitive information confidentially
- Offer general support to visitors
- Ensure equipment operation by performing preventive maintenance, calling for repairs, maintaining equipment inventories, and evaluating new equipment and techniques
- Maintain supplies inventory by checking stock to determine inventory level, anticipating needed supplies, placing and expediting supply orders, and verifying receipt of supplies
- Perform other functions that may be assigned from time to time.
